Clue: Folksy thumbs-down
Answer: NAW
Explanation of clue:
The clue “Folksy thumbs-down” in the New York Times crossword puzzle is ingeniously matched with the answer “NAW.” This term is an informal, colloquial way of saying “no,” often used in casual conversation to express disagreement or refusal. The use of “folksy” in the clue signals that the answer is a more relaxed, down-to-earth manner of speaking, rather than a formal or standard one. “NAW” is frequently associated with regional dialects in the United States, particularly in the Southern and Midwestern areas, where it adds a touch of local color to the language. Its phonetic simplicity and the casual nature make it a fitting response when someone wants to politely or humorously decline something without sounding too harsh or direct.
